Navarathiri Day 2
Sri Brahmi is the Alangaram of the Mariamman on the second day of Navarathiri.
Brahmi is said to be the kind and benevolent form of the Mother Godess.
From the very name Brahmi, we can assume that she must be associated
with the creator God Brahma as his Shakthi meaning Power.
Brahmi is one of the seven Mantrikas, similar to our Sapthakannihaihal.

The Andal temple
The majestic towers of the popular Andal Kovil of Srivilliputhur greets the devotees well in advance before they reach the town.We visit the temple at least once in a year but only during our latest visit, the grandeur of the gopuram was captured in the camera.
It is a matter of great joy and pride for my mother in law that the Rajagopuram of the Andal temple of her home town, Srivilliputhur is the official emblem of our state.Naturally the town happens to be the birth place of my spouse and his two sisters.The Andal Ther is very magnificent to look at on the move. Really blessed and fortunate are those, outside the town, who can make to that occasion on the day of Thiruadipooram,the birth day of the great Vaishnavite saint and composer,Andal, whose Pasurams vibrate in the dawn during the month of Margazhi.
An ancient Siva temple at Madarvilagam, 2 km. from the Andal temple is also worth seeing. The town of Srivilliputhur is also well known for its pure milk sweet,called Palkova.No visitor to the town returns without the Palkova.
